Red Hat (RHAT) To Trade on NYSE as of December 12, 2006 Under Ticker "RHT"
Red Hat, Inc. (NASDAQ: RHAT) has filed an application to list its common stock on the New York Stock Exchange. Upon approval of its application, the Company anticipates that its shares of common stock will begin trading on the NYSE on December 12, 2006, under the symbol "RHT".
"The move to the New York Stock Exchange is a significant event for Red Hat. We believe that listing on the New York Stock Exchange will increase Red Hat's visibility among investors, reduce trading volatility and offer more efficient pricing," said Charlie Peters, CFO at Red Hat.
